Docker无法识别我的系统上的Hyper-V,没有MobyLinux虚拟机,如何创建?

Docker无法识别我的系统上的Hyper-V,没有MobyLinux虚拟机,如何创建?

问题描述:

我在我的系统上启用了Hyper-V(并重新启动)。然后,我安装了“Docker for Windows”。每次启动Docker时,它都会给我带来同样的错误。 enter image description hereDocker无法识别我的系统上的Hyper-V,没有MobyLinux虚拟机,如何创建?

我想,不知何故,我的机器上没有创建MobyLinux虚拟机。 enter image description here

如何配置手动吗?

+0

你试过重新安装吗? –

+0

是的。很多时间。重新安装,重新启动,启用/禁用Hyper-V。 – Yasin

码头工人无法在启动时创建VM。这是因为某些PowerShell模块未包含在路径中。

检查为电源外壳模块配置的路径$env:psmodulepath 注意:以管理员身份使用PowerShell。

的路径为 “C:\ WINDOWS \ SYSTEM32 \ WindowsPowerShell \ V1.0 \模块” 必须出现在上述名单。如果不是,请修改以下注册表: H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Session Manager\Environment以包含此缺少的路径。

卸载并重新安装泊坞窗。